Saturnine Games is bringing Cosmos X2 to Europe on the Nintendo DSiWare™ service on September 15, 2011. In Cosmos X2, players journey through space fending off an alien invasion in classic 16-bit inspired shoot ‘em up action.
Take control of the Cosmos X2 spacecraft as it travels through the solar system in search of the alien home world. Equip your ship with your choice of two alignments, each featuring a unique attack style and defensive shield. Arm yourself with the Repulsion Alignment for a spread attack with a wide range of fire and reflective shielding. The Attraction Alignment provides homing attacks and a shield that can regenerate energy by absorbing enemy attacks. The Power Alignment provides maximum strength weapons and a devastating explosive shield that damages nearby enemies. Switch between alignments at any time during battle, but use them wisely as each has its own health meter.
Cosmos X2 will be available in the Nintendo DSi™ Shop (available on the Nintendo DSi and Nintendo DSi XL™ systems) for 200 Nintendo DSi Points™ as well as in the Nintendo eShop (available on the Nintendo 3DS™ system) for €2.00.

This information comes from Activision Publishing boss Eric Hirshberg…
“It does make the hardware more relevant and compatible to the style of games we make. I don’t have anything to announce in relation to that, but I think it was a great move and it opens up that platform to more styles of games.”
If anything, perhaps Activision will be more open to bringing certain types of titles to the 3DS once the Circle Pad accessory becomes available. I could definitely see the add-on benefiting a Call of Duty title, if n-Space or another studio were to make such a project for the handheld.

Nintendo’s Kirby Snack Attack Truck Delivers Fruit and Fun to New York City in Honor of New Kirby Mass Attack Game
Posted on 13 years ago by Brian(@NE_Brian) in DS, News | 0 comments
Customized Kirby Truck to Help Area Fans Attack Snack Time with Frozen Fruit Treats and Hands-On Video Game Demos
–(BUSINESS WIRE)– Nintendo:
WHAT:
To give hungry fans a fun way to attack snack time, Nintendo has something special in store for folks in New York City and beyond. On Sept. 14, a customized Kirby Snack Attack Truck will offer frozen fruit treats to fans around New York’s Rockefeller Plaza to help mark the launch of the new Kirby™ Mass Attack game for the Nintendo DS™ family of systems. While enjoying these tasty snacks, participants can enjoy hands-on demos of Kirby Mass Attack, in which gobbling up fruit allows players to accumulate a mass of up to 10 Kirbys at a time. In addition to Rockefeller Plaza, the truck will make a special stop at an area school. Other Kirby Snack Attack Trucks will be visiting the San Francisco Bay Area and the aptly named Upper Kirby neighborhood of Houston. The truck tour will culminate in a special visit to the GameStop store in Upper Kirby on Sept. 18.Launching across the United States on Sept. 19, Kirby Mass Attack is playable on the Nintendo DS family of hand-held game systems – which includes Nintendo DS, Nintendo DSi™ and Nintendo DSi XL™ – as well as the Nintendo 3DS™ system. The game offers a fun twist for new and experienced Kirby fans. Unique touch-screen controls let players control up to 10 Kirbys at a time as they take down enemies and break through obstacles across five colorful, side-scrolling worlds. They can build up a mob of Kirbys by eating fruit, and as their swarm gets bigger and more powerful, they can access new areas and defeat tougher enemies.
